Casey’s Completes Financing for Recapitalization Plan
Casey’s General Stores Inc. has completed a private placement for $569 million of 5.22% senior unsecured notes due 2020. BP Cements Well, Assesses Damage
On Aug. 5, BP completed cementing operations at the MC252 well. The procedure began at 9:15 a.m. CDT and was completed by 2:15 p.m. CDT, as part of the static kill plan. By filling the damaged Macondo well with cement from the top down, the company hopes to guarantee it won’t leak oil again. The…
